Chapter 5
Congruent Triangle Proofs
IN THIS CHAPTER
Proving triangles congruent with SSS, SAS, ASA, AAS, and HLR
CPCTC: Focusing on parts of congruent triangles
Eying the two isosceles triangle theorems
Working with the equidistance theorems
You’ve arrived at high school geometry’s main event: triangle proofs. The proofs in Chapters 2 and 3 are complete proofs that show you how proofs work, and they illustrate many of the most important proof strategies. But they’re sort of just warm-up or preliminary proofs that lay the groundwork for the real, full-fledged triangle proofs you see in this chapter.
